接口编程高效利器:深度解读电脑配置推荐130


接口编程,作为现代软件开发的核心技术,对电脑配置的要求日益提高。高效的接口编程不仅需要熟练的编程技巧,更离不开一台性能强劲、稳定可靠的电脑作为支撑。本文将深入探讨接口编程对电脑配置的需求,并给出针对不同编程场景的电脑配置推荐,帮助各位开发者选择最合适的“利器”,提升开发效率和体验。

首先,我们需要明确一点:接口编程并非单指某一种编程语言或框架,而是涵盖了多种技术和场景,例如 RESTful API、GraphQL API、gRPC 等,以及与之相关的数据库操作、版本控制、代码调试等。因此,对电脑配置的要求也并非一概而论,而是需要根据具体的项目需求和编程习惯进行选择。

一、核心配置要素及影响:

1. 处理器 (CPU): 处理器是电脑的“大脑”,负责执行程序指令。接口编程通常涉及大量的计算、数据处理和网络通信,因此需要一个高主频、多核心的处理器。对于大型项目或高并发场景,多线程处理能力至关重要,建议选择英特尔酷睿i7或AMD Ryzen 7及以上级别的处理器。较低的核心数和主频会直接导致编译速度缓慢、程序运行卡顿等问题,严重影响开发效率。

2. 内存 (RAM): 内存是电脑的“临时存储器”,用于存放程序运行时所需的数据。接口编程过程中,往往需要同时运行多个程序,例如IDE、数据库客户端、浏览器等,以及加载大量的项目文件和库。因此,充足的内存至关重要。建议至少配备16GB内存,对于大型项目或需要运行虚拟机进行测试的开发者,建议考虑32GB甚至64GB内存。

3. 固态硬盘 (SSD): 固态硬盘的读写速度远高于传统的机械硬盘,这对于接口编程来说至关重要。大量的项目文件、虚拟环境、数据库等都需要快速的读取速度,才能保证开发过程的流畅性。选择容量至少512GB的 NVMe PCIe 4.0 固态硬盘,能够显著提升项目的加载速度、编译速度以及整体开发效率。机械硬盘可以作为补充存储,但关键数据和项目文件应优先存储在SSD中。

4. 显卡 (GPU): 虽然接口编程对显卡的要求相对较低,一般不需要高性能的独立显卡,但对于一些需要进行数据可视化或使用图形界面库的项目,配备独立显卡能够提升效率和体验。集成显卡一般能够满足大部分需求,但如果涉及到复杂的图形处理或机器学习相关工作,则建议配备独立显卡。

二、不同编程场景的电脑配置推荐:

1. 小型个人项目或学习用途:

CPU: Intel Core i5 或 AMD Ryzen 5

内存: 8GB

SSD: 256GB

显卡:集成显卡

2. 中大型项目开发或团队协作:

CPU: Intel Core i7 或 AMD Ryzen 7

内存: 16GB - 32GB

SSD: 512GB - 1TB

显卡:集成显卡或入门级独立显卡

3. 高性能计算、大数据处理或机器学习相关接口编程:

CPU: Intel Core i9 或 AMD Ryzen 9

内存: 32GB - 64GB

SSD: 1TB 以上

显卡:中高端独立显卡 (例如 NVIDIA GeForce RTX 3060 或 AMD Radeon RX 6600 以上)

三、其他重要因素:

1. 操作系统: 选择稳定的操作系统,例如 Windows 10/11 或 macOS,并保持系统更新。Linux 系统也适用于接口编程,但需要一定的学习成本。

2. 开发工具: 选择合适的 IDE(集成开发环境),例如 IntelliJ IDEA、Visual Studio Code、Eclipse 等,并安装必要的插件和扩展。

3. 网络连接: 稳定的高速网络连接对于进行网络编程和与远程服务器交互至关重要。

4. 散热系统: 良好的散热系统可以保证电脑长时间稳定运行,避免因为过热导致程序崩溃或系统故障。

总而言之,选择合适的电脑配置对于高效进行接口编程至关重要。根据自身需求和项目规模选择合适的配置,才能在开发过程中事半功倍,提升效率,最终提高软件开发的质量。

2025-06-19


上一篇:电脑编程音乐键盘:从代码到旋律,探索音乐编程的奇妙世界

下一篇:零基础也能轻松入门!CIAI电脑编程课深度解析